不同升温速率干馏对页岩油品质的影响

Analysis on properties of shale oil pyrolyzed from oil shale at different heating rates

【摘要】 升温速率是影响油页岩热解及页岩油品质的重要因素之一。本文通过对页岩油的密度,黏度,凝点,倾点,发热量,馏程及元素分析在不同升温速率下的变化规律,来阐述升温速率对页岩油品质的影响。研究结果表明,随着升温速率的增加,页岩油的密度值逐渐变大。在实验温度为50℃条件下,页岩油的黏度值逐渐增大;然而凝点、倾点值是先增加后减小的;且发热量是逐渐减小的。不仅如此,馏程实验中不同温度段馏分的产量在不同升温速率下在极小的范围内波动。以上结果表明,升温速率对页岩油品质具有一定影响。通过对这一影响因素的分析,丰富了页岩油工业化生产的基础性研究工作。

【Abstract】 As is well known,heating rate plays an important role in the pyrolysis of oil shale and the evaluation of shale oil quality in most cases.In this paper,the analysis of density,viscosity,solidification point,pour point,calorific value,distillation as well as ultimate analysis of Huadian shale oil was carried out to elucidate the regularities of heating rate on the quality of shale oil.The results showed that the density of shale oil increased gradually with a rise of the heating rate.At the experimental temperature of 50℃,the viscosity of shale oil increased;however,the solidification point and pour point of shale oil first increased and then decreased; besides,the calorific value of shale oil decreased gradually.Furthermore,the variation of fraction obtained at each temperature period limited to a very small range.These results indicated that heating rates had a certain impact on the quality of shale oil.The analysis of the influencing factor of heating rate could enrich the basic research work of industrial production of shale oil.
